Financial markets software developer Devexperts is rolling out a new mobile interface for its flagship product DXtrade, which targets firms in the brokerage space.
The firm says the new interface is designed especially to enhance traders’ experience when using the platform on a mobile, and features all basic trading functionalities, including market, limit, and stop orders; position modification; and protection orders such as stop loss and take profit.
It adds traders using the app will be able to view their accounts, including all relevant account metrics; browse predefined watchlists; search instruments and access instrument charts; and manage their portfolios and execute trade operations.
Currently available only in a demo environment, the firm says the new features will be made available to brokers licensing the DXtrade platform for trader use “in the coming weeks”.
“We know that traders like to be able to access their platform whether they’re at their desk or on the move, ensuring effective portfolio management and, where appropriate, timely trade execution,” says Jon Light, head of OTC platform at Devexperts. “This is the motivation behind our new DXtrade mobile interface, which gives traders even greater flexibility when it comes to accessing their platform, whenever and wherever they wish.”
